Resident Evil 4 Remake Surpasses 9 Million Copies Sold: A Capcom Triumph

Capcom's Resident Evil 4 remake has achieved phenomenal success, surpassing 9 million copies sold since its March 2023 release. This milestone follows the recent 8 million sales mark, highlighting the game's enduring popularity. The surge in sales is likely attributed to the February 2023 release of the Resident Evil 4 Gold Edition and a late 2023 iOS port.

The remake, a significant departure from the original's survival horror roots, features a more action-oriented gameplay style. Players follow Leon S. Kennedy as he confronts a sinister cult to rescue the President's daughter, Ashley Graham.

The CapcomDev1 Twitter account celebrated the achievement with celebratory artwork showcasing beloved characters like Ada, Krauser, and Saddler. A recent update further boosted the game's performance, particularly for PS5 Pro users.

Record-Breaking Sales and Fan Expectations

According to Resident Evil expert Alex Aniel (author of Itchy, Tasty: An Unofficial History of Resident Evil), Resident Evil 4 boasts the fastest sales in the franchise's history. This surpasses even Resident Evil Village, which reached 500,000 copies sold in its eighth quarter.

This remarkable success fuels anticipation for future Capcom releases. Many fans eagerly await a Resident Evil 5 remake, a possibility made more plausible by the less than one-year gap between the Resident Evil 2 and 3 remakes. Other potential candidates for a modern remake include Resident Evil 0 and Resident Evil CODE: Veronica, both crucial to the series' overarching narrative. Naturally, news of a Resident Evil 9 would also be met with great enthusiasm.
